Built across the Mahanadi River in Odisha, the Hirakud Dam stretches over 25 kilometers, making it one of the longest dams in the world. Engineers highlight that it plays a crucial role in flood control, irrigation, and power generation, while also creating a vast reservoir with scenic islands.
